Text
If an inspector finds any pest or disease which is known to be contagious in any apiary, the inspector may hold the apiary and may require that abatement be performed under his or her direct supervision. The inspector shall give notice that the apiary is held to the owner or bailee and post a copy of the notice in a conspicuous place in the apiary.
